Regional Supervisor Water Quality Regional Operations Section Washington Regional Office 943 Washington Square Mall Washington NC 27889 Subj ect: Notice of Deficiency: NOD-2021-LV-0017 Notice of Violation: NOV-2021-LV-0089 Monteray Shores WWTP Permit WQ0009772 Dear Mr. Tankard: In reference to the Notices of Deficiency and Violation dated February 9, 2021, and received by CWS on February 24th, we offer the following response: The facility experienced an upset on June 2, 2020 in which three of the five membranes were blinded and flow rates exceeded the capability of the remaining two. The cause of the upset is believed to be a combination of excessive discharges of cleaning products from resort properties ahead of a late tourist season start associated with COVID delays along with floor stripping chemicals from a local shopping center. Operations has contacted those involved in the discharge to make them aware of alternative disposal methods. Staff immediately began remedial cleaning of the membranes and diverted flow to upset, but it took several months to completely remove the foreign substance and recover the treatment process.
